There's something very British about runners dressing up and drinking wine in the surrey countryside. Having ran this previously I enjoyed the route change. There are plenty of Marshalls and supporters . The drink stops become rather congested at times. Not sure what the solution is to solve this. The bands seems to have reduced this year which is a shame but nev the less everyone had a great time. When you finish you collect your medal and you get a hog roast or a veggie alternative and another drink of your choice. Thankfully the weather was good and everyone say around on the grass enjoying themselves. Not sure what would have happened if the weather wasn't as kind. The vineyard also provide a discount in their shop which is great to take home some of the fab wines you sampled on the course. Everything works really well. Minimal queues for toilets, bag collection etc. The scenery is great and everyone who doesn't know the area is really taken in by it all.
